This week: Heart failure and a new neuro-oncology program

Nurse Natasha Zmitrowitz provides an overview of heart failure, explaining how many people with the diagnosis are able to live full lives, perhaps with some lifestyle modifications. In this episode of “HealthLink on Air” she goes over the signs and symptoms, how the disease is diagnosed and how it is treated.

Also on this week’s program, Dr. Ruham Nasany unveils the neuro-oncology program at Upstate. Nasany is a neurologist who specializes in the treatment of tumors of the brain and spine. She is one of 260 certified neuro-oncologists in the United States. Listen this Sunday, September 27 at 6 a.m. and 9 p.m. for more.
